Bone grafting (sometimes called bone augmentation or guided bone regeneration) is a careful procedure that adds new bone material to areas of your jaw where it's needed. It's used when your existing bone isn't quite strong enough, deep enough or wide enough to support a dental implant on its own.

Implants work because of a remarkable natural process called osseointegration, where your jawbone fuses directly to the titanium implant. For that to happen reliably, the bone needs enough volume and density to hold the implant firmly. Without it, the implant simply won't stay put.

Our in-house 3D CBCT scanner is what makes bone grafting decisions so much more accurate than they used to be. A traditional 2D X-ray only shows you so much. A 3D scan lets us see the precise width, height and density of your bone before any treatment is planned - meaning fewer surprises and more predictable results.

A 3D scan shows us exactly what your bone looks like. We'll then plan whether grafting is needed, what kind, and whether it can be done at the same time as implant placement or as a separate stage.
The procedure is carried out under local anaesthetic, with IV sedation available if you'd prefer. For minor grafting, the whole thing is often done at the same time as your implant placement. For larger cases, it's done first.
Over the following weeks and months, your body slowly converts the graft material into your own new bone. This stage can take three to nine months depending on the size of the graft and your individual healing.
Once the new bone has matured properly, your implant can be placed into a strong, stable foundation. From here, your treatment follows the standard dental implant journey.

Is bone grafting uncomfortable?
The procedure itself is carried out under local anaesthetic, so you won't feel pain at the time. Most patients describe mild tenderness or swelling for a few days afterwards, similar to (or sometimes less than) having a tooth taken out. IV sedation is available if you'd prefer to feel more relaxed throughout.
How long does the bone need to heal before an implant can go in?
For minor grafting done at the same time as your implant, no extra waiting is needed. For staged grafting (where bone is rebuilt first), healing typically takes three to nine months depending on the size of the area.
What is bone graft material made from?
Several different materials can be used, including synthetic options, processed donor bone, or bovine-derived material - all carefully regulated and safe. Will bone grafting be successful for me?
In experienced hands, with careful planning and proper healing time, bone grafting is genuinely predictable. Success rates are very high. The main factors that affect outcome are smoking, oral hygiene, and overall medical health - all of which we'll discuss honestly at your consultation.
What happens if a bone graft doesn't take properly?
It's uncommon, but it does occasionally happen - usually due to infection or healing problems. If it does, we'll talk you through your options. In most cases, we can allow the area to heal and try again once the conditions are right.
Can bone grafting be done at the same time as a tooth extraction?
Yes - and it's often the smartest approach. Placing bone material into the empty socket at the time of extraction (sometimes called atraumatic extraction for implant) preserves bone for a future implant and avoids more involved grafting later.
